def _run_in_fresh_loop(coro: Coroutine[Any, Any, None]) -> None:
|
||||
"""Run *coro* to completion in a dedicated thread with its own event loop.
|
||||
|
||||
The e2e_ui suite runs many pytest-playwright **sync** tests in the same
|
||||
session; once one has run, pytest-asyncio can't start a loop on the main
|
||||
thread. Running the coroutine from a fresh thread via :func:`asyncio.run`
|
||||
sidesteps that. Any exception (including assertion failures) is captured
|
||||
and re-raised on the calling thread so the test fails normally.
|
||||
|
||||
:param coro: The coroutine to run to completion.
|
||||
:raises Exception: Whatever the coroutine raised, re-raised here.
|
||||
"""
|
||||
captured: dict[str, Exception] = {}
|
||||
|
||||
def _worker() -> None:
|
||||
try:
|
||||
asyncio.run(coro)
|
||||
except Exception as exc:
|
||||
captured["error"] = exc
|
||||
|
||||
thread = threading.Thread(target=_worker)
|
||||
thread.start()
|
||||
thread.join()
|
||||
if "error" in captured:
|
||||
raise captured["error"]
